Once the initial thought has been decided upon, high-fidelity prototypes are used, that are extra detailed visible proposals that embody interactive elements and specific UI components that will be used. These prototypes use the real fonts, colors, and designs that will be used within the finished product and are usually offered to stakeholders for last approval before the event process begins. Firstly, it might be the UX designer’s position to combine desk-based and area research to get a full picture of who they’re designing for. This would possibly include reviewing what the present web site has to supply, interviewing current customers to establish opportunities and pain-points, and doing competitor research to see what else is on the market. It is essential to be aware that UX designers are not usually answerable for the visible design of a product.

A UX researcher is required to harness a quantity of completely different strategies and methodologies to assemble the quantitative and qualitative data what does a ux designer do they want. These practices embody interviews, surveys, usability testing, and knowledge analysis.

Begin by gaining relevant education, similar to incomes a level in fields like interplay design or graphic design. It’s additionally essential to develop a stable understanding of UX principles through self-study or on-line courses. Constructing a powerful portfolio that demonstrates your UX design abilities and problem-solving abilities is important. Even when you have no particular prior expertise, you can begin getting career-ready with a course or certification in UX design. Look for a course or program where you’ll be taught the basics, get hands-on expertise with the newest UX design tools, full tasks on your portfolio, and community with others in the industry.
